Subject: Floor 4 is open!

Hi all — quick note from the front desk: the new fourth floor at Pellerton House opens Monday. Team assistants can start booking the meeting rooms up there from today. Kitchen's stocked, printers arrive Wednesday. The stairwell door stays badge-locked for now, so you'll need the code below.

door code, yagap-bahof: bdg-O-05

Flip the traffic flag
# only after the idle color passes its warm-up checks (schema
# version match, queue lag under 5s, zero failed probes for two
# minutes). Never flip mid-batch: in-flight invoices must drain
# first or duplicates are possible. Rollback is the same flag,
# reversed. Both colors share one ledger database, and each worker
# reads its connection string from the line below.

primary connection of yagep-kahip = redis://giliel_svc:zYiKsLL2PLpfPL@db-348f.xolmarsys.corp:5432/fenwyn

Changelog 2.9.0 — CatImport defaults changed. The library catalogue importer now batches MARC records at 500 instead of 100, retries soft failures three times, and skips duplicate-barcode checks on trusted feeds from the Brindlewick consortium. Existing overrides are untouched; only fresh installs get the new behaviour. For reference at the sync, the new defaults are listed below.

settings of tagef-bawif:
DRUIX_HOST=druix.zemvarlabs.internal
DRUIX_PORT=8000